The Covid-19 vaccines will be ready for rollout in 10 days from the emergency use authorisation date based on feedback from the dry run, the government said today, ending speculation about the time frame that started since the drug regulator's approval on Sunday. Two vaccines have received approval -- Oxford University's Covishield, which is being developed by the Pune-based Serum Institute, and Bharat Biotech's Covaxin.
